| dentate |
The condition where the margins of a leaf (or leaflet) have relatively large jagged projections, but not so large as to be considered lobes. Arrowwood Viburnum is a good example of a shrub with leaves having dentate margins.

| dentate convolution |
A small, notched gyrus, rudimentary in humans, situated in the dentate fissure.
